Character Design Contest ♯127- What a bunch of posers

Ok, starting this week, I'm going to do a series of challenges for you guys, to really test your skills with the 'machine. And we're going to kick of with a challenge centred around posing. We did this sort of challenge a while back, so everyone should know the drill. You cannot use the standard face-forward pose. The pose has to be of your own creation, so you can't use pre-made poses from the forums custom item section. Also, I'm only judging on the pose and, to an extent, how well you've adapted the costume elements to the pose, so don't include backgrounds. That'll come later.

As per usual, no limits on entries and the contest will close at midnight Saturday (blog time). Please read the contest rules before entering, have fun and good luck.

Character Design Contest ♯126- Contest Again

Ok, I'm gonna try something a bit out there this week. One of the main rules I ask people to follow for these contests is do not enter something you have entered into a previous contest. However, this week I am actively encouraging you to, if not break the rule, certainly bend it into new and interesting shapes.

What I want you to do is find one of your old contest entries and redo it. It can be from any contest (apart from the previous two contests, they're too recent), not just ones I've run, but from Jeff or HammerKnights contests as well. Just make sure you include the original for comparison, I want to see how much everyone has improved.
